DISFIGURED ELEGANCE formed in Montreal, Qubec, Canada in mid 2009 at a time when its members were but a mere 15 to 17 years old. With a lineup consisting of Mathieu Paquette (vocals), guitarists Patrice Plouffe and Pierre Luc Gagnon, Sebastien Hamelin (bass), and drummer Cedrik Drouin, the quintet set out to craft a creative and powerful brand of metalcore
